Description

Wow! Just Wow!

This home, built in 1851, is full of period features and offers all the Victorian Charm and Character you could wish for.

Situated near the top of Knights Hill it enables the home to take advantage of the stunning field views that reach as far as the eye can see and can be enjoyed via the garden, nearly every window and the two balconies too.

As you enter the gates the driveway sweeps you to the right and you are then met with this generous and gorgeous detached home as well as the Garage. Between the house and the Garage is a gate that leads to a private courtyard and to the side of the property is an enormous garden and beautiful landscape views.

Through the large red period front door and into the Entrance Hallway you are charmed by the beautiful Minton tiling. This Hallway then leads you to the three Reception rooms, Cloakroom and WC, the Cellar, Kitchen Diner and the stairs to the first floor.

The Living Room is my favourite room of the house as it is flooded with natural light, has the amazing views that look like a picture in every window and balcony too, and has the open fire and surround as a focal point. There is plenty of space in here for multiple seating to enjoy the space as a family.

The Snug, located opposite the Living Room, is currently being used as an office but at different periods of time the family have used it as a playroom and then snug too for the little ones as they have grown up. This too has an open fire with a gorgeous surround.

The Dining room has views of the courtyard and has ample space for a formal dining table and chairs set. As the Kitchen is large enough to be a Kitchen Diner if you didnt want a formal dining room this could be used as another seated reception room.

The Kitchen Diner was an addition to the house and offers fitted wall and base units for storage, range cooker and space for table and chairs. This leads off to the Utility Room, has the back door to gain access to the Garden and the door to access the Courtyard that leads to the Garage too. With views of that garden you will be fighting over who is doing the washing up!

The Garage has a side access door from the Courtyard and double doors to the front. Internally there are space saving stairs that lead up to the first floor that benefits from a porthole window to allow for natural light and offers endless possibilities for usage.

Off the Hallway is the Cellar - with 3 zonal spaces down here it could be used for storage but also opens up the possibility for even more living space if needed.

As you glide up the stairs to the first floor you are met with an imposing stained glass feature window. On the first landing there are stairs that lead down to the separate shower and bathroom.

Back up the stairs and onto the generous landing where you can access the five double bedrooms. Bedrooms 2-5 have ample space for bed and bedroom furniture, ideal for a family as no need to fight over the bedroom sizes here! Bedroom 5 has balcony access and due to its position next to the ensuite and above the bathroom it could be changed and renovated into another bathroom if all 5 bedrooms were not needed.

The Master Bedroom has an inner hallway that leads to the bedroom with fitted wardobes and the ensuite bathroom.

There is loft access from the landing that benefits from a ladder, light and insulation and is perfect for storage and offers scope again for further development if needed.

Externally the garden not only offers the views but great spaces to enjoy as a family or when entertaining friends. With some tiers and different zones there are plenty adventures for the children to have.
